How to Use the Official OKC County / Oklahoma County Inmate Search
The Oklahoma County Detention Center website has an Inmate Search section that links to Jail Tracker for current inmates in custody. Use this official path first because it is designed for current custody lookup, not old arrest history or broad people-search results.
How to Check OKC County Inmate Charges and Booking Details
Jail Tracker may show custody and booking information, but court records are better for formal case movement. If you see charges online, treat them as allegations until a court resolves the case.

How to Check Bonds, Warrants and Walk-Through Warrant Information
The Oklahoma County Detention Center has a Warrants and Bonds page. It points users toward Oklahoma court-record resources such as OSCN and ODCR to check open cases and possible warrants. It also gives process information for walk-through warrant handling.
How to Check OKC County Inmate Release Date or Custody Status
Release timing is one of the most confusing parts of an inmate search. A person may be eligible for release but still waiting on paperwork, warrants, transport, court orders, bond verification, identity checks, or another agency hold.
For current Oklahoma County jail custody, check Jail Tracker and VINE. For Oklahoma Department of Corrections state custody, release date rules are different. ODOC explains that an inmate’s release date may be confidential unless the requester has a legitimate need.
Why You Cannot Find Someone in OKC County Inmate Search
If someone does not appear in the Oklahoma County inmate search, there are several possible reasons. The person may not be booked yet, may already be released, may be in another county, may be in state or federal custody, or may be listed under a different spelling.
| Problem | Likely Reason | Best Next Step |
|---|---|---|
| No result by full name | Spelling, nickname, middle name, suffix, hyphen, or data-entry issue. | Search last name only or try shorter spelling variations. |
| Arrest happened today | Booking may not be completed yet. | Check again later or call the detention center. |
| Person disappeared from Jail Tracker | Possible release, transfer, court movement, or agency hold change. | Use VINE, check court dockets, or call OCDC. |
| Court case exists but no jail record | The person may not currently be in county jail custody. | Use OSCN or ODCR for court records. |
| State custody issue | The person may be in Oklahoma Department of Corrections custody. | Use the Oklahoma DOC Offender Lookup. |
| Federal custody issue | The person may be in federal custody. | Use the Federal Bureau of Prisons inmate locator. |

How to Use VINE for Oklahoma County Custody Notifications
VINE is useful when you need custody-status alerts instead of checking the jail search again and again. The Oklahoma County Detention Center’s VINE page says VINE is free, confidential, and can provide custody status and criminal case information.
When to Use OSCN or ODCR for OKC County Criminal Case Records
Jail Tracker answers the custody question: “Is this person currently in Oklahoma County jail?” Court records answer the legal-case question: “What is happening with the criminal case, warrant, bond, hearing, or docket?”

Practical OKC County Inmate Lookup Tips
- Use “Oklahoma County” when searching official records. “OKC County” is common user wording, but the official county name is Oklahoma County.
- Start with Jail Tracker. It is the direct route for current Oklahoma County custody lookup.
- Check OSCN and ODCR for court details. Jail records do not always explain the full court case.
- Use VINE for status alerts. This is better than manually refreshing the jail search all day.
- Be careful with bond-payment scams. Confirm every payment route through official court or detention center channels.
- Do not assume release is instant after bond. Processing, holds, warrants, or court orders can delay release.
- Check state custody separately. If someone has been sentenced or transferred, use Oklahoma DOC Offender Lookup.
- Do not treat charges as convictions. Jail booking details are not final court outcomes.
OKC County Inmate Search FAQs
How do I search for an OKC County inmate online?
Use the official Oklahoma County Detention Center website and click the Inmate Search / Jail Tracker link. This is the best starting point for current Oklahoma County jail custody.
Is OKC County the same as Oklahoma County?
Most people searching “OKC County inmate search” mean Oklahoma County, which includes Oklahoma City. Use Oklahoma County Detention Center resources for county jail lookup.
What is the Oklahoma County Detention Center phone number?
The detention center lists phone numbers 405-907-1930 and 405-504-6811.
Where is the Oklahoma County Detention Center?
The facility address is 201 N. Shartel Ave, Oklahoma City, OK 73102.
How do I check Oklahoma County inmate charges?
Start with Jail Tracker for custody details, then use OSCN or ODCR to check criminal case dockets, charges, warrants, hearing dates, and court status.
How do I check Oklahoma County bond or warrant information?
Use the OCDC Warrants and Bonds page, OSCN, ODCR, or contact the detention center. Do not pay anyone until the bond amount and payment process are officially confirmed.
Can I find an OKC County inmate release date online?
You can check custody status through Jail Tracker and VINE. Exact release timing can change quickly, and for Oklahoma DOC state custody, release-date information may be confidential unless there is a legitimate need.
How do I get notified when an Oklahoma County inmate is released?
Use VINE / VINELink for confidential custody-status notifications. OCDC also says front desk staff can explain the victim-notification process.
Why can’t I find someone in OKC County Jail Tracker?
The person may not be fully booked, may have been released, may be in another county, may be in state or federal custody, or may be listed under a different name spelling.
Are OKC County jail charges proof of guilt?
No. Jail records and booking charges are not proof of guilt. A person is presumed innocent unless proven guilty in court.
